Who is Israel's US envoy leading talks with Lebanon?
"Yechiel Leiter, a settlement activist and US-born Israeli, has been a prominent figure in Israeli politics, known for his far-right affiliations and controversial rhetoric during conflicts in Gaza and Lebanon."
"Israel's ambassador to the United States, Yechiel Leiter, held a first-ever phone call with his Lebanese counterpart, marking a significant diplomatic break from tradition amid ongoing violence."
"Israel has carried out near-daily attacks on Lebanese territory since a ceasefire began in November 2024, violating the truce and complicating peace negotiations."
Yechiel Leiter, Israel's ambassador to the US, has a history of far-right affiliations and contentious rhetoric. He recently engaged in a historic phone call with Lebanese ambassador Nada Hamadeh Moawad, marking a significant diplomatic step despite the lack of formal relations. Global pressure is mounting on Israel due to the ongoing conflict in Lebanon, resulting in over 2,000 deaths and more than one million displaced. Israel plans to initiate formal peace talks with Lebanon, although Hezbollah's rejection of direct negotiations poses challenges to the peace process.
